Nigel,

the rule is that 'for sale' items up to £100 can go on the forum, beyond that you pay to put it in the magazine. Aircraft and anything of a high value therefore go into the magazine at a cost.

You'll perhaps not agree that it's an ideal arrangement, but it does create revenue and gives a wider audience than the forum which only a small percentage of the membership participate in.

It's a system that has worked ok for a while now.

It is sensible to review how we handle classified advertising from time to time and we will certainly take a fresh look at things when we (hopefully) launch a completely new website later this year.
In the meantime, following a request from the last NC meeting, from the next (May) issue (the April issue has now gone to press), we will be trialling free member's ads for items of £50 or less. All members have to do is email me the details (do not use the usual HQ address) and their ad will be placed in the next available magazine. I hope this will encourage members to dispose of those little items that they are unlikely ever to use but which might be of real benefit to somebody else.
